First Team Manager
Responsible For:
Providing coaching and team management for the First Team squad and ensuring that the team fulfils all fixtures for the league as entered by the club.
Responsibilities of the Role:
- The primary purposes of the role are to help guide and develop individuals and where appropriate help them progress within semi-professional level football.
- The successful candidate will be responsible for all aspects of activity regarding the squad.
- To provide a quality coaching environment in a safe, controlled and enjoyable way including the planning and delivery of training sessions in line with team and player requirements.
- Manage their team in line with the principles and identity of the football club
- Be inventive/develop new ideas to promote our club's vision and values.
- Weekly team selection to include liaising with Club management
- Periodic player appraisals and feedback
- Monthly Review meeting with Club Officials
- The organisation of coaching/training sessions.
- The organisation of team matches.
- Support the club's development model to create and enhance a player pathway from youth to adult football.
- Reporting of results to Club Secretary & Media team after matches.
- Work with Reserve Team Managers to ensure players are getting developed into First Team.
- Management of player disciplines and escalation of issues to the Clubs Committee.
Requirements of the role:
- The club ideally requires a minimum UEFA B FA Certificate in Coaching Football or substantial management experience and a desire to achieve this.
- An in-date FA Safeguarding Children Certificate or a willingness to achieve it.
- Since you may be working with players under the age of 18, it is club policy that all club officials require a valid FA Enhanced Disclosure (CRC check).
- Sign up to the club's codes of conduct.
- Follow the FA's Respect guidance for safeguarding.
